Moses Hurt 1768–1863 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 1768

Birth Location: Henry, Virginia, USA

Death Date: 09 Feb 1863

Death Location: Stuart, Patrick, Virginia, USA

Father: Joseph *

Mother: MARY Hart

Spouse(s): Mary Palmer

Children(s): Mary Hurt

In 1768, Moses Hurt entered the world in Henry, Virginia, USA, born to Joseph Hurt And Mary Elizabeth Polly Wilson Gg5 Hart. Moses Hurt married Mary Branham Palmer, and had children including Mary A Polly Hurt. Moses Hurt passed away in 1863 in Stuart, Patrick, Virginia, USA.
